Is your splash shield damaged? If not, just resecure it.

I had a similar problem with my wife's Hyundai Elantra. I bought a replacement, on E-bay, and secured it with plastic rivets (using a rivet gun) that I purchased from Harbor Freight. Very easy. On the Challenger, the splash shield is secured by small metal screw bolts (M6X1.00X25.50).

The primary function of an engine splash shield (or belly pan) is to protect the engine from debris, water, and other harmful elements on the road. It serves as a barrier between the engine and the road, preventing dirt, rocks, and other debris from damaging the engine’s vulnerable components. The splash shield also helps to keep the engine clean, which can improve its performance and longevity.

Another benefit of an engine splash shield is that it helps to improve your car’s aerodynamics. By reducing the amount of air that flows underneath the car, the splash shield can help to improve fuel efficiency and reduce wind noise.
